Unable to save a few Local Settings #211

Closed GoogleCodeExporter closed 8 years ago

GoogleCodeExporter commented 8 years ago
What steps will reproduce the problem?
1. Open Local Settings dialog;
2. Configure anything in "Authentication" and "Proxy" tabs for any server - 
"Default" or hand-made;
3. Close dialog with "Save" or "Save and Connect";
4. Open Local Settings again - there are all settings clean.

What is the expected output? What do you see instead?
"Authentication" and "Proxy" settings should work :)...

What version of the product are you using? On what operating system?
Transmission Remote v3.13 (build 3655)

Please provide any additional information below.
The problem is simple and reproducable. Always...
